Foundations of Crystallography with Computer Applications 3rd Edition
Foundations of Crystallography is an extraordinary detailed account into the key concepts needed to gain a firm understanding in crystallography.
The text is indeed authoritative ; dedicating a great many pages to the subject in comparison to other texts on the subject. This is to its credit, as it presents a much more detailed and precise description than its competitors. One example where this is evidently exhibited is in the introductory chapters.
In my own experience, I have never seen a book on condensed matter physics describe so painstakingly what lattices are and the symmetries which they possess. This is supported by numerous illustrations and worked examples. In particular, this text makes great use of colour in images to distinguish different properties, structures and aspects of crystallography. This is indeed rare in the field and to my knowledge there exists no other text book on the subject that is as well illustrated as this one. This point is symptomatic of the lack of new or indeed pedological offerings on the subject; which is has remained evermore so important to the physical sciences.
An additional feature which makes this text stand out from the rest is the supplied code repository which allows for students to see how the techniques they've seen in theory can utilised practically. I commend the authors in writing this code in python (a programming language which is becoming increasingly essential to the education), which allows for easy integration into any degree course.
Finally, this text is complete in its presentation. When ever mathematical initiation is needed (such as linear algebra and group theory), it is introduced in a way which is accessible to the student, no matter their background. The authors provide detailed examples for each of the different crystal systems, beyond the usual basic ones given in other texts. Furthermore, there is also suggestion for further reading and projects the students can undertake.
